The Job Interview: Before The

Interview

Practice what and how you’re going to communicate to the person interviewing you.

Pick out a sharp outfit suitable for the interview.

Make sure you know how you’re getting to the interview so you don’t arrive late.

Stay calm and collective. Get a good night’s rest and eat a proper breakfast in the morning.

The Job Interview: During The

Interview

Be polite; listen carefully and do not interrupt.

When answering questions be confident and always be honest.

Keep a good posture weather you are sitting or standing.

Don’t be afraid to smile.

Have questions ready to ask at the end of the interview.
